Default Time format in userform textbox

Hi all,

I thought this would be an easy solve but it has me baffled. I've read
quite a few old posts and still haven't a solution so would appreciate
any help.

I have a textbox on a userform I am trying to set to a time format.
(The textbox is bound to a ws cell and this is set to time format)

I have tried all of the below;

UserForm5.Controls("TextBox" & i).Text = Format$(ws.Range("g" & K),
"Short Time")
UserForm5.Controls("TextBox" & i).Text = Format$(ws.Range("g" & K),
"h:mm")
UserForm5.Controls("TextBox" & i).Text = Format$
(sheets("sheet4").range("g" & K), "H:mm")
UserForm5.Controls("TextBox" & i).Text = Format(ws.Range("g" & K),
"Short Time")
UserForm5.Controls("TextBox" & i).Text = Format(ws.Range("g" & K),
"h:mm")
UserForm5.Controls("TextBox" & i).Text =
Format(sheets("sheet4").range("g" & K), "H:mm")


None of which have worked - the time still shows as a decimal. I'd
appreciate any pointers as i'm baffled and getting very frustrated!
